Best Internet Providers in Jonesboro, AR

The top three internet providers in Jonesboro are AT&T Fiber, Optimum and Ritter. AT&T Fiber is the best internet provider of the three because it offers all the benefits of fiber, such as symmetrical speeds up to 5 Gbps, low latency, better bandwidth and the most stable connection type you can find. AT&T Fiber plans start at $34 per month. AT&T Fiber offers bundle options with its TV and wireless services for additional savings. The provider also offers other connection types, such as AT&T Internet and AT&T Internet Air. AT&T Fiber is recognized for fast speeds and exceptional customer service, earning the provider a top ranking in J.D. Power's 2024 U.S. Residential Internet Service Provider Satisfaction Study for the North Central and West regions.

The second best internet provider in the area is Optimum. Optimum provides lightning-fast download speeds up to 940 Mbps and excellent bundle deals by adding Optimum TV and Optimum Mobile to its internet service. Customers don't have to worry about data caps or annual contracts, and basic equipment is included. Optimum also offers a guided self-install option to help you avoid installation charges.

For a local provider option, Ritter offers an alternative choice for fiber internet in Jonesboro. With decent availability across the Jonesboro area, Ritter has several fiber plans available. These plans provide symmetrical gigabit speeds up to 5 Gbps. Like the other best providers in the city, Ritter doesn't require contracts and doesn't impose data caps.

Fastest Internet Providers in Jonesboro, AR

The fastest internet providers in Jonesboro are AT&T Fiber, Ritter and Optimum. AT&T Fiber's symmetrical speeds are more than enough horsepower for the average household. AT&T Fiber also boasts that its fiber connections are 25 times faster than cable. A fiber network transfers data faster over longer distances, which is why it's the gold standard of the internet.

Ritter ties AT&T Fiber as the fastest ISP in the area. Ritter's fiber technology delivers impressive symmetrical gigabit speeds up to 5 Gbps, which is more than enough for most consumers. Ritter covers less area of Jonesboro than AT&T Fiber, however, but it's a great option if it's available in your neighborhood.

Optimum is also known for amazing download speeds. The provider's cable connections can support speeds up to 940 Mbps. Although Optimum can't deliver symmetrical speeds like AT&T Fiber and Ritter, Optimum is more accessible than many competitors in the area.

Internet Availability in Jonesboro, AR

You have a few different options to get a high-speed, wired home internet service in Jonesboro. AT&T Fiber, Optimum, and Ritter Communications all offer great speeds and reliable connections. However, each major provider covers different areas of the city. The providers you can choose from will depend on where you live, so here are the neighborhoods they cover.

AT&T Fiber offers service to 43.7% of the city, with the northwest corner getting better coverage than anywhere else. Starting from the Jonesboro Country Club, coverage extends westward to the end of Nettleton Avenue. It also reaches north (to Johnson Avenue) and south (until Alexander Drive). Don't expect to get coverage in neighborhoods to the southeast like Nettleton and Fallis.

Optimum is available to 83.4% of the city, meaning you can get almost blanket coverage across the area. The only exceptions to Optimum's excellent availability are neighborhoods surrounding Arkansas State University. Think of The Village and Williamsburg Apartments, as well as several spots near Saint Bernards Medical Center.

Ritter Communications has decent fiber internet availability in Jonesboro, with coverage concentrated in the southeast. This is great news if you don't have access to AT&T Fiber. Ritter provides comparable fiber speeds to neighborhoods AT&T Fiber doesn't cover, like Nettleton, Ward 6, and Southside. However, there is little coverage in the northeast in areas like Northside and around the City Water and Light Park.

For residents in the wider Jonesboro area, it's worth mentioning a regional provider, empower internet. Although it doesn't cover areas inside the Jonesboro city limits, empower offers great coverage just outside the city in nearby towns, such as Gilkerson and Brookland.
